Homebush West History

Homebush West, originally known as Flemington, became part of Strathfield Council in 1892. This publication offers a historical overview of the suburb. Future editions will explore other areas of Homebush West, particularly those west of Marlborough Road. Comments are welcome.

The Boulevarde street trees 1913

The 1913 Sydney Mail edition highlighted The Boulevarde Strathfield’s tree-lined streets, likely amongst the first in the area. The local council received a significant grant in 1889 for tree planting, creating distinctive double-planted streets. By 1890, about 5,000 pounds were spent to plant eight kilometers of streets, contributing to Strathfield’s renowned tree-lined avenues.
